이번 팀과제는 리듬게임을 하기로 했다.

휴일이 길어서 그동안 간단하게 공부할 것들을 정하고 게임의 방향성과 계획을 짰다.

 

<필수 구현 계획>

노래에 맞게 노트 생성(JSON을 통해 실시간으로 직접 노트를 찍거나 단순히 BPM에 맞게 노트 생성)

노트 타격 판정

타격에 따른 애니메이션

콤보 및 점수

 

<선택 구현 계획>

사용자 모드(사용자가 원하는 노래 추가 및 노트 생성)

일정 콤보가 되면 피버 타임 구현

음량 조절

 

전체적으로 8Bit 컨셉으로 노래 또한 8Bit로 몇 가지 만들 생각이다. 에셋은 각자 원하는 것을 하나씩 가져와서 상의 후 결정하기로 했다.

주말에 이론강의 + 수준별 강의를 정주행하고 하고 개인 과제 때 오브젝트 풀에 대해 정확히 이해하지 못하고 사용한 것 같아서 좀 더 공부해야겠다. 개인과제에서 전체적인 설계가 많이 무너졌기 때문에 초기에 설계를 확실히 짜고, 특히 이전 강의에 나왔던 애니메이션과 FSM의 스크립트 구조를 공부해볼 생각이다.

+ Recent posts